TVC NEWS [ABUJA] - A Federal High court in Abuja on Tuesday resolved to hear pending applications from the defendants along with the substantive suit challenging General Muhammadu Buhari’s eligibility to contest Saturday’s Presidential election.

It is also to decide whether or not to grant leave to the parties seeking to be joined in the matter.

TVC News Joke Adisa reports that Buhari’s counsels led by Lateef Fagbemi had approached the court with two applications and insisting that those applications be heard and ruled upon before the commencement of the substantive suit.

The defence counsel is challenging the jurisdiction of the court to hear the matter in the first place while also insisting that his client was not properly served the originating summons.

But delivering ruling on the applications, Justice Adetokunbo Ademola held that both contending applications would be heard along with the substantive suit, though, no date has been fixed for it yet.

A new twist has however been added to the case as a Lagos-based lawyer, Ebun Olu-Adegboruwa and one other person are seeking to be joined as defendants citing their notable contributions to the growth of Nigeria’s democracy.

The court has however fixed Wednesday, 25 for ruling on the application for joinder.

Chike Okafor, a Nigerian dragged Buhari to court alleging among others that the former Head of State is not eligible to contest the Presidential election
